What are some considerations for incorporating outdoor entertainment systems into a pool house design?

When designing a pool house, one important aspect to consider is the incorporation of outdoor entertainment systems. Outdoor entertainment systems can greatly enhance the overall experience and enjoyment of a pool house, providing additional entertainment options and creating a more inviting and relaxing atmosphere. Here are some key considerations to keep in mind when incorporating outdoor entertainment systems into a pool house design.

1. Purpose and Placement

Firstly, determine the purpose of the outdoor entertainment system. Will it be primarily used for watching movies, listening to music, or both? This will help determine the type of equipment needed and the ideal placement within the pool house. Consider factors such as visibility, sound projection, and accessibility when deciding where to install the system.

2. Waterproof and Weatherproof Equipment

Since the pool house is an outdoor structure, it is vital to choose equipment that is waterproof and weatherproof. This includes outdoor-rated televisions, speakers, and other audiovisual components. Ensure that all equipment is designed to withstand exposure to the elements, including rain, humidity, and extreme temperatures.

3. Wiring and Connectivity

Proper wiring and connectivity are essential for an outdoor entertainment system. Ensure that the pool house has the necessary infrastructure to support electrical outlets, cables, and internet connections. Consult with an electrician or audiovisual professional to ensure proper installation and connectivity for the system.

4. Integrated Control System

Consider incorporating an integrated control system for the outdoor entertainment system. This will allow for seamless control of multiple audiovisual devices from a central control panel or mobile device. Integration can include features such as adjusting volume levels, switching between audio and visual sources, and controlling outdoor lighting.

5. Outdoor Sound System

One of the key components of an outdoor entertainment system is the sound system. Select speakers that are specifically designed to deliver high-quality audio in outdoor environments. Consider the layout and size of the pool house to determine the number of speakers needed for optimal sound distribution.

6. Screen Placement and Visibility

If incorporating a television or projector screen, consider the placement and visibility within the pool house. Ensure that the screen is easily viewable from multiple seating areas and that there is minimal glare or reflections. Optimize screen placement to provide the best viewing experience for all users.

7. Lighting and Ambiance

Lighting plays a crucial role in creating the right ambiance for an outdoor entertainment system. Incorporate adjustable lighting options that can be dimmed or brightened as desired. Consider installing outdoor-rated lighting fixtures, such as LED strip lights, to enhance the overall visual appeal of the pool house.

8. Furniture and Seating Arrangements

When designing the pool house, consider the furniture and seating arrangements that will best accommodate the outdoor entertainment system. Choose comfortable and durable furniture that is suited for outdoor use. Arrange seating in a way that allows for optimal viewing and interaction with the entertainment system.

9. Aesthetics and Integration

Ensure that the outdoor entertainment system seamlessly integrates with the overall design and aesthetics of the pool house. Consider using materials and colors that complement the existing structures or themes. Conceal wiring and components as much as possible to maintain a clean and visually appealing appearance.

10. Regular Maintenance and Upkeep

Lastly, remember to plan for regular maintenance and upkeep of the outdoor entertainment system. Regularly clean and inspect the equipment to ensure proper functioning and longevity. Consider using equipment covers or storage solutions to protect the system during periods of inactivity or inclement weather.

In conclusion, incorporating outdoor entertainment systems into a pool house design requires careful consideration of purpose, placement, waterproofing, wiring, control systems, sound, screen visibility, lighting, furniture, aesthetics, and maintenance. By taking these factors into account, you can create a pool house that provides a truly immersive and enjoyable entertainment experience for all users.
